Detection
How PhotoBroom finds them
Photos taken within a configurable time window of each other (five minutes by default) are compared using Apple Vision feature prints. Shots whose prints fall within a similarity threshold are clustered into a group. The highest-scoring photo in each group is highlighted and pre-selected.
How you review them
A full-screen comparison view. Swipe horizontally between shots in a group, vertically between groups, and pinch to zoom to spot the difference between two near-identical frames.
Questions
Does deleting similar photos in PhotoBroom remove them permanently?
No. PhotoBroom deletes through the standard iOS photo confirmation sheet, so nothing is removed without your explicit approval, and everything you delete goes to Recently Deleted in the Photos app, where iOS keeps it for 30 days before removing it for good. If you change your mind, recover it from there.
Is Similar Photos free to use in PhotoBroom?
Yes. Every cleanup category in PhotoBroom is free to browse and clean, and scan results are never hidden behind a paywall. Free users can delete 50 items of any type per calendar day, plus 2 large videos. PhotoBroom Pro removes that daily limit.
What does PhotoBroom need to find similar photos?
PhotoBroom needs photo library access and runs on iPhone and iPad with iOS 18.0 or later. It works with limited library access if you would rather grant only part of your library. All analysis happens on your device — no media is uploaded and no account is required.
